The "Imam Ali Mosque" at Najaf is a spectacular gold-domed mosque that enshrines the tomb of Ali ibn Abi Talib, the Prophet Muhammad's cousin and the husband of his beloved daughter, Fatima. Ali is the first of 12 Imams. Most Shiites revere 12 Imams as successors and descendants of Muhammad. The Imams have divine powers to intercede between God and the Believer. The 12th Imam is believed not to have died in the ninth century but to have been "hidden." He is expected to return as the Mahdi, a powerful Messianic figure. Injured US Marine at Najef cemeteryThe Najaf cemetery has centuries of religious history and it is where Shiites want to be buried. Shiites believe that Imams have the capacity to act as intercessors between Shiites and God on the day of the Resurrection. That is why many Shiites prefer to be buried in the cemetery in Najaf. This is in order to be in close proximity to the Imam so they will be among the first resurrected.
